Focus on these interior fortifications was even now ongoing when, on the night of 28 September, the first features of Washington's army arrived and created camp outside Yorktown. Cornwallis, not eager to distribute his troops also skinny, abandoned the redoubts on Pigeon Hill, and as a substitute pulled his Adult males again on the inner line of defense. Working day and evening, Focus on these trenches ongoing, the two by troopers and countless runaway slaves – who experienced arrive at Yorktown hoping the British would give them liberty – while the British sunk huge ships within the York River to hinder a Franco-American amphibious landing.

But war-weariness was by now increasing in Parliament, along with the defeat at Yorktown proved being the ultimate straw. In early 1782, Primary Minister Lord North and his cupboard resigned following the Household of Commons handed a no-self esteem movement, and The brand new cabinet commenced peace negotiations that ultimately resulted within the Treaty of Paris of 1783, ending the war. Though minimal skirmishes even now took place, the Siege of Yorktown was the last substantial fight of the war, cementing its legacy as one of An important battles in US history.

In the total siege, around four hundred French and American soldiers were being killed or wounded, even though British and German casualties numbered about 600 killed and wounded, and close to seven,600 surrendered. Cornwallis and his officers, who were invited to dine Along with the American and French officers within the night time in the surrender, were being sooner or later paroled, and click here lots of British officers remarked over the civility proven to them. Although it was immediately obvious which the Siege of Yorktown had been a vital American victory, it didn't always sign an conclusion towards the preventing; Clinton was still in New York City along with his Military, as well as the British preserved strong army presences in Charleston, copyright, and from the West Indies, bases from which they might have launched new offensives.
